Job Summary

About the Position: This position is located in Fort Buchanan, Puerto Rico. Fort Buchanan is the only active U.S. Army installation in Puerto Rico and the Caribbean. Spanning over 746 acres, it is located within the San Juan metropolitan area across the municipalities of Guaynabo, Bayamón, and San Juan.

Minimum Qualifications (Screen Out Element): Ability to do the work of a(n) Motor Vehicle Operator Leader without more than normal supervision. To meet the screen out element, applicants should document experience or show the ability to do the following: operating motor vehicles, providing on-the-job training or leadership; performing routine vehicle inspection; and prioritizing work.- Failure to meet this Screen Out Element will result in an ineligible rating. You will be evaluated on the basis of your level of competency in the following areas: Ability to Drive Safely (Motor Vehicles) Ability To Interpret Instructions, Specifications, etc. (related to mobile equipment operation) Ability To Lead or Supervise Operation of Motor Vehicles Work Practices (includes keeping things neat, clean, and in order) Working Conditions: Drives in all types of traffic and weather and is exposed to the possibility of serious accidents. The operator is subject to cuts, bruises, and broken bones as a result of accidents while driving or when loading and unloading vehicles. Physical Efforts: Light physical effort is used in reaching, bending, turning or moving hands, arms, feet and legs to operate hand and foot controls. Moderate physical effort is required in the unloading and loading of children with special needs and their equipment, as well as assisting these students off and on the bus.
